Transaction 3e42bf626cad88ae4f968041a844fc9955289816d549902788f1394aad6508fe
1 Input
1 Output
-
3e42bf626cad88ae4f968041a844fc9955289816d549902788f1394aad6508fe:0
- value
- 94579
- script pubkey
- OP_0 OP_PUSHBYTES_20 98bdac350c9469354b9a3a5e0a81a69b72410cbc
- address
- bc1qnz76cdgvj35n2ju68f0q4qdxndeyzr9uuc5ul3